Structural Crack Repair in Sarasota, FL
Structural crack repair services focus on identifying and addressing cracks that develop in the foundation, walls, or other structural elements of a property. These repairs are essential for maintaining the stability and safety of a building, whether the cracks are caused by settling, shifting soil, or other structural issues. Projects can range from small surface cracks to larger, more significant fractures that threaten the integrity of the structure, often requiring specialized techniques to ensure long-lasting results.
Homeowners typically want to understand the severity of the cracks, the potential causes behind their formation, and the best methods for repair. It’s important to evaluate whether cracks are superficial or indicative of underlying problems that need more extensive intervention. Before requesting repair services, property owners should consider the location, size, and pattern of the cracks, as well as any related signs of foundation movement or water intrusion, to help determine the most appropriate course of action.

Structural Crack Repair Questions
What types of cracks are suitable for repair? Cracks that are active, wide, or cause structural concerns can typically be repaired to prevent further damage and improve stability.
How does crack repair help property owners? Repairing cracks can enhance the integrity of the structure, prevent water intrusion, and reduce the risk of further deterioration.
What signs indicate the need for crack repair? Visible cracks in walls, ceilings, or foundations, especially if they widen or change over time, suggest the need for assessment and possible repair.
What materials are used for crack repair? Common materials include epoxy, polyurethane, or hydraulic cement, chosen based on the type and location of the crack.
